Gwyneth Paltrow’s ski crash trial has left viewers baffled as the plaintiff's lawyer kept making "awkward" comments to the Hollywood star. The Shakespeare in Love actress and founder of Goop is on trial over claims she injured retired optometrist Terry Sanderson in a "hit-and-run" ski slope crash. But Sanderson’s attorney Kristin Vanorman appeared to gush over Paltrow as she took the stand last week.
In once clip, the prosecutor asked Paltrow: "You were wearing goggles, a helmet? Kind of looked like everybody else on the slope?"
"That's always my intention," Paltrow replied.
"Probably had a better ski outfit though I bet," Vanorman said, smiling and pointing at Paltrow.
"I still have the same one," Paltrow replied, laughing.
A later clip shows Vanorman telling Paltrow how jealous she is that Paltrow is 5 feet 10 inches tall, but they both agree that they're now shrinking.

The trial took place at the Third Judicial District Court in Park City, Utah on Friday, and centres on Sanderson’s claims Paltrow skied into the back of him.
The Oscar-winning actress countersued and claimed Sanderson, 76, actually skied into the back of her while at the Deer Valley Resort in Park City, Utah on February 26, 2016.

While Sanderson initially launched a legal action against Paltrow for $3.1 million, he was forced to reduce the claim to $300,000.
He says he was left with "permanent traumatic brain injury, four broken ribs, pain, suffering, loss of enjoyment of life, emotional distress and disfigurement," after a "full body hit" by Paltrow.
She launched a counter-suit in 2019 for just $1 plus her legal fees.
The trial, which started on Tuesday 21 March, will last a total of eight days, the length agreed by judge Kent Holmberg and both sides' attorneys.
